"Immediately after a ban on using hand-held cell phones while driving was implemented, compliance with the law was measured. A random sample of 1,250 drivers found that 98.9% were in compliance. A year after the implementation, compliance was again measured to see if compliance was the same (or not) as previously measured. A different random sample of 1,100 drivers found 96.9% compliance."

a. State an appropriate null and alternative hypothesis for testing whether or not there is any statistical difference in these two proportions measured initially and then one year later.
b. Conduct the test of hypothesis you stated in part a). Be sure to check the conditions for your test. State the P-value of your test and your conclusion.
